This code point first appeared in version 1.1 of the Unicode® Standard and belongs to the "CJK Unified Ideographs" block which goes from 0x4E00 to 0x9FFF.

Encodings (Unicode characters converter)
The following character table converter for +u7493 allows you to see the value of the character in different encodings
encoding | hexadecimal | decimal | binary |
---|---|---|---|
UTF-8 | E7 92 93 | 15176339 | 11100111 10010010 10010011 |
UCS2 | 93 74 | 37748 | 10010011 01110100 |
UTF-16LE | 93 74 | 37748 | 10010011 01110100 |
UTF-16BE | 74 93 | 29843 | 01110100 10010011 |
UTF7 | 2B 64 4A 4D 2D | 186366184749 | 00101011 01100100 01001010 01001101 00101101 |
UTF7-IMAP | 26 64 4A 4D 2D | 164891348269 | 00100110 01100100 01001010 01001101 00101101 |
